Chewy Peanut Butter Brownies Recipe Everyone Will Love

Chewy Peanut Butter Brownies

These blondie-style peanut butter brownies are soft, chewy, and rich with creamy peanut butter. The recipe makes about 24 brownies and is ready in approximately 40–45 minutes, plus cooling time.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Servings: 24 servings

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ients
  • 1/2 cup (113 g) Butter, softened
  • 1 cup (200 g) Granulated sugar
  • 1 cup (about 213 g) Packed light brown sugar
  • 2 eggs Large eggs, preferably room temperature
  • 1 cup (about 255 g) Creamy peanut butter
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la extract
Dry Ingredients
  • 1 1/2 cups (about 180 g) All-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on Ba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on Salt

Method
 

Step-by-Step
  1. Heat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 13 x 9-inch baking pan.
  2. Cream the softened butter, granulated sugar, and packed light brown sugar until light and fluffy.
  3. Beat in the eggs one at a time, then mix in the creamy peanut butter and vanilla extract until smooth.
  4. In a separate b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king powder, and salt.
  5.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the peanut butter mixture, mixing only until combined.
  6. Spread the thick batter evenly in the prepared pan.
  7. Bake for 25–30 minutes, until the edges are lightly golden and a toothpick inserted near the center shows moist crumbs rather than wet batter.
  8. Cool for at least 20–30 minutes before slicing; the brownies become firmer and chewier as they cool.

Notes

Use regular creamy peanut butter rather than separated natural-style peanut butter for the most consistent batter. Do not overbake; a toothpick with a few moist crumbs is the best sign that the brownies are ready.
